Student societies are groups created and led by students. They are often based around common interests, activities, arts, political views, religion, culture and faith.

Societies are based within the Students’ Union. The have their own governing constitution and must abide by the Students’ Union constitution. Each Society must have a President, Treasurer and Secretary. Societies run events, socials, hold meetings, campaign on issues and much more.

Any student who is a member of the Students’ Union can set up or join a society.
